Lucie BIBEAU was born 23 April 1826 in Saint-Antoine-de-Tilly, Lower Canada

Lucie BIBEAU was the child of François-Xavier BIBEAU   and   Julie CROTEAU and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Pierre BIBEAU and Marie-Josephte HOUDE (maternal)  Jean-Baptiste CROTEAU and Victoire AUGER

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Lucie  married  Alfred BERGERON 23 August 1847 in Saint-Antoine-de-Tilly, Canada East .  The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Alfred BERGERON  was born 3 May 1827 in Saint-Antoine-de-Tilly, Québec, Canada.  Alfred died 30 November 1872 in St-Flavien, Quebec, Canada.  Alfred was the child of Antoine BERGERON and Louise GENEST.
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
